Brief summary
Pilot, single center, open-label study to evaluate the efficacy and tolerability of Grazoprevir and Elbasvir in HCV GT1 and 4 liver transplant recipients.30 liver transplant recipients with hepatitis C recurrence.
Interventions
Grazoprevir 100 mg/ day 12 weeks
Elbasvir 50 mg/day 12 weeks
Ribavirin 1200 mg/day 16 weeks
Elbasvir 50 mg/d 16 weeks

Eligibility
Inclusion criteria
* Age between 18 and 78 year-old. * Previous liver transplantation(more than 6 month). * Genotype 1 and 4 infection. * Hepatitis C recurrence defined by the presence of abnormal liver function test, positive HCV-RNA, histological signs of hepatitis C recurrence. * Viral load ≥10000UI/mL. * Immunosuppression with tacrolimus and/or mycophenolate (Prednisone use is allowed at low dose, ≤10 mg/d). * Treatment naïve or treatment experienced (Peg-RBV or triple therapy).
Exclusion criteria
* Genotype 2, 3, 5 or 6 infection. * Decompensated cirrhosis defined by the presence of actual or previous history of clinical decompensation including ascites, hepatic encephalopathy, variceal bleeding or spontaneous bacterial peritonitis, or a Child-Pugh B or C. * Hepatocellular carcinoma after liver transplantation. * Total bilirubin \> 3 mg/dL. * Immunosuppression with cyclosporine or an mTOR inhibitor (everolimus or sirolimus). * Severe extrahepatic diseases: cardiovascular, respiratory, cerebrovascular and poorly controlled diabetes. * Platelets \< 75 x 109 cells/L. * Neutrophil count \< 0.5 x 109 cells/L. * Hemoglobin \< 9 g/dL. * Albumin \< 3g/dL. * HIV infection. * Hepatitis B infection. * Active intake of toxic amounts of alcohol or recreational drugs. * Females who are pregnant, become to be pregnant or breastfeeding or males whose partners are pregnant, become to be pregnant or breastfeeding. * Intake of disallowed medications including(but not limited to): 1. Antibiotics: clarithromycin, erythromycin, telithromycin, nafcillin, rifampin 2. Antifungals: itraconazole, ketoconazole, voriconazole 3. Antihypertensives: nifedipine 4. Anticonvulsants: carbamazepine, phenytoin, phenobarbital 5. Bosentan 6. Modafinil 7. St.Jonh's Wort 8. Immunosuppressants: cyclosporin, everolimus, sirolimus 9. Diabetes agents: glibenclamide, glyburide 10. Lipid lowering agents: gemfibrozil 11. Eltrombopag 12. Lapatinib 13. HIV medications: efavirenz, etravirine, all ritonavir boosted and unboosted HIV protease inhibitors 14. Statins: simvastatin, fluvastatin, rosuvastatin at doses greater than 10 mg/d, atorvastatin at doses greater than 10 mg/d.
Design outcomes
Primary
| Measure | Time frame | Description |
|---|---|---|
| Sustained virological response | 12 weeks post-treatment | Sustained virological response 12 w (SVR24) defined as HCV-RNA undetectable at post-treatment week 12. |
